Jessica, have you considered a pinched nerve from the neck?  Some moms
make certain that baby is well positioned and latched, but don't pay
proper attention to their own comfort.  I have seen moms in some of the
most awkward positions that would have to hurt after a while.  If this
mom has been nursing while leaning forward, perhaps she has caused a
spasm in her neck and upper back.  A good physical therapist, massage
therapist may be able to give her some relief.
